ACC Dental School - The Nightmare
Went back to ACC dental hygienist school and met my new student. She was very personable and nice , but told me that she was not doing very well and could possibly fail at her dream of being a dental hygienist.
She started her eval and then set me for another visit.
I came back two more times , all to continue this very long eval (12 hours total) Then I get disturbing news from student that she is having problems with all my dental work. She says to me that she cant tell where the real teeth stop or start, which really kinda spooks me , thinking what have I got myself into ?
She tells me she will have to double up on the cleaning to get it done in time, I agree. She sets a time with me, and then from what I have gathered changed that time with my partner, and did not communicate or ask me anything on the change of time.
I did my best getting to every appointment early and stayed as long as they needed. The whole time the student communicated directly with me , and I with her.
One week later from last visit, I get a letter saying I am no longer in program due to missing to many appointments. I got very upset, and decided to call. What I got from the call was that the school has no customer service for patients in program, and that the school would not release to me a copy of the communications, evidence due to it would violate the student' HIPPA rights.
Here I was being pushed out after making 12 hours of investment.
The school had my number since it was able to call me back to tell me first yes , then no, on being able to get copy of communications. This would be proof of the HIPPA violation, I figured.
Since I had been here before, I new I was already supposed to have 2 quadrants cleaned by this time, and feel the school violated HIPPA in speaking to partner without communicating with me ( not a single call or text) and ACC department covered itself by terminating me from program , and not having to reject students performance or grade.
I had been very ill , and had to reset an appointment due to uncontrollable vomiting, which I am under medical treatment for. They knew I was ill when I entered the program. I still can not believe how they treated me, and then swept the students failures and bad performance under the carpet.
I have asked to meet with the dean of the school, and they tell me they have lots of deans, but no one is in charge .
